Account Safety at BoostRoyal
Nothing in our data confirms how BoostRoyal handles logins, addresses or session visibility, and we are not going to invent a security stack to fill the hole. What we can report is our own run: 7 paid orders spread across the catalogue, none of which came back with a penalty on the accounts we used. That is a genuine result on a small count, and it is still 7 outcomes rather than seventy.
The one-star pile is where the safety question actually lives. An October 2025 reviewer says his account was banned and accuses the boosters of playing without protection on top of it. We cannot verify a claim like that from outside, and one angry post is one post. Eleven percent one-star on 9775 ratings is a high floor for a 4.8 shop, though, and the shape of that tail tells you more than any single story in it.
No boosting shop makes a borrowed login invisible to Riot or Valve. Exposure here is small, not absent, and it grows the moment someone plays your account from a city you have never queued from. Treat the order as a window you open and then close: rotate the password once the job wraps, turn on whatever two-step the game offers, and glance at the match history before you file the whole thing away.
Booster Screening
BoostRoyal publishes nothing in our data set about how it recruits or screens the people taking jobs, so judge it by behaviour instead. Across our run of 7 orders the work looked like real players climbing: no odd gaps, no handoffs mid-order, no account arriving back with a stranger's settings on it. Sixteen minutes of average pickup also implies a bench deep enough to cover eleven games without parking your order in a queue.
Against that sits the accusation buried in the one-star reviews - that some of the climbing gets done on botted accounts rather than by the roster on the front page. We saw nothing of the sort in our own jobs, and we are not going to convict a shop on a stranger's post. It is the one thing we would ask about directly if you are handing over an account with years of skins on it, because a screening process nobody describes is a process you are taking on trust.
Customer Support
Every exchange we had ran through the order thread, and on all 7 jobs someone answered inside the same session rather than leaving the message hanging overnight. That is the practical read: the people attached to a live order respond. What our data cannot tell you is the published coverage window, so if you are ordering from a timezone far from Europe, ask something trivial before you pay and see how long the reply takes.
One caveat on tone. Support here is order-scoped, meaning the useful conversation happens with the booster running your climb, and pre-sales questions get the thinner treatment. That is normal for a shop this size, but it does mean the person who can actually fix a stalled job is the same person playing it - fine when the run goes well, awkward if you need someone above them.
What Happens After You Pay
- Pick the game first. Each of the eleven catalogues runs its own calculator and its own base rate, so a Fortnite quote and a CS2 quote have nothing in common except the checkout.
- Dial the two ends of the climb into the calculator - the rank you hold now and the one you are buying - then add extras like duo play, a preferred agent or priority handling. Every toggle moves the running total before you commit.
- Pay in full at checkout. The quoted figure locks at that point and the job appears in your dashboard with the order thread attached.
- A booster picks the job up. Across the 7 orders we paid for, that step averaged sixteen minutes, and the slowest of them still resolved the same evening rather than the next day.
- Follow the climb in the order thread and take the account back when the target lands. Reset the password, re-check the security settings, and you are done.

Do I have to give BoostRoyal my account?
For standard division boosting, the account changes hands - that is how the work gets done here, and there is no per-win option that avoids it. Duo play is the exception, where you keep the login and queue alongside the booster for a higher rate. If handing over credentials is a hard limit for you, price the duo option first and see whether the total still makes sense.
